Embryonic NIPP1 Depletion in Keratinocytes Triggers a Cell-Cycle Arrest and Premature Senescence in Adult Mice

    Marloes Jonkhout, Tijs Vanhessche, Mónica Ferreira, Iris Verbinnen, Fabienne Withof, Gerd Van der Hoeven, Kathelijne Szekér, Zahra Azhir, Wen‐Hui Lien, Aleyde Van Eynde, Mathieu Bollen
    TLDR Deleting NIPP1 in mouse skin cells causes early aging and chronic skin issues.
    The study investigates the effects of embryonic NIPP1 depletion in keratinocytes on adult mice. The results show that the absence of NIPP1 triggers a cell-cycle arrest and leads to premature senescence in these mice. This finding suggests that NIPP1 plays a crucial role in maintaining normal cell function and preventing early aging in skin cells.
